Shattuck had already won two in a row (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 7 runs) and they went ahead and made it three on Monday. They came out on top against the Leedey Bison by a score of 5-2. The Indians have seen this before: they got the W the last time they saw the Bison, too.

Shattuck's victory was their seventh stra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 20-3. The road wins came thanks in part to their hitting performance across that stretch, as they averaged 11.0 runs over those games. As for Leedey, with the defeat, they broke their three-game winning streak and moved their record to 10-9-1.
As of now, neither Shattuck nor the Bison have any future games scheduled.
